Police lathi-charged the agitators in ECB premises, barricaded in Paltan-Sciencelab-Dhanmondi-Mirpur, many arrested

Online Desk:

Published: 06:45 29 July 2024
The police lathi-charged the agitators in the capital's ECB premises and stopped them at Paltan, Sciencelab, Dhanmondi and Mirpur. Many people were arrested at this time. This incident happened on Monday afternoon.
Earlier, a group of protesters gathered at the ECB premises. At that time, the police removed the agitators by baton charge and arrested some of them.
A police officer on duty said that the protesters were throwing bricks from inside the alley. They were later removed by the police. He said that some people were arrested at that time.
On the other hand, eight to ten agitators can be seen taking a position at Paltan intersection. Various slogans are also seen demanding the trial of student murder and the release of those arrested. The police stopped there.
At this time, traffic stopped at Paltan junction. The police took a strong position in front of the press club with a vehicle from this morning. At present, the road in front of the Press Club is closed to traffic.
The police arrested four students including a co-coordinator of the anti-discrimination student movement from there.
It is known that one of the co-coordinators of the anti-discrimination student movement and a student of Dhaka University, Mosaddek and Rafi, are among the four arrested.
Police arrested several protestors in front of Mirpur 10 in the capital and Star Kabab in Dhanmondi.
